Academica seeks to ease the process of identifying potential doctorial/master’s advisors for prospective students Also, aids academics/researchers in collaborative research

With a magnitude of information available online and no easy way to curtail relevant from irrelevant information related to professors

Create easily digestible biographies that overcome usability issues of a professor’s website Many are outdated or poorly designed

Focus on visualization - Quickly spot and see where funding is going and what resources the funding is achieved from

VIVO is the most similar to the functionality of Academica, as it strives to create an interface for academic collaboration.

Limited use – People must setup their own profile for optimal use (citations/bibliographic data)

Difference: Does not focus on funding or citation count

Offers a basic bio, yet not automatically generated and users can pick and chose what is visible.

The system is lacking in graphic visualization – only shows funding amounts as numbers and not visual (only textual)

Limited to searching and seeing citation count and co-investigators

Must create custom profiles on Google if desire for more personalization

Microsoft automatically generates a profile – but lacks funding information

Help students better analyze potential advisor’s to see his/her funding and if there is a research fit A student may see the historical view of the professor, yet

over time this perspective/research focus might change Data is automatically generated – No interaction by the

professors (since little incentive to incorporate data) Focus, focus, focus on visualization – Better understand

funding and where it comes from – try to see influence of such funding on professors or their research
